About This Item
Random House, 1975. About VG book is clean and tight. Not ex-library. Worn, price clipped dust jacket to be in Brodart protector. Short, small gift inscription on FEP, otherwise book unmaked. 29 stories, short stories and novelettes by different authors. 368pp Shipped in sturdy cardboard box. . Hard Cover. About VG/Fair-Good. 8vo - over 7¾" - 9¾" tall.

Glossary
Some terminology that may be used in this description includes:
- Tight
- Used to mean that the binding of a book has not been overly loosened by frequent use.
